Coquelin 'did not want Arsenal return'

Arsenal midfielder Francis Coquelin has revealed that he did not want to return to the club back in December.

The Frenchman is now a regular in the Gunners starting XI, but started the season on loan at Charlton Athletic.

The 24-year-old was recalled to the squad just before Christmas due to injury problems, and admitted to reporters that he was reluctant to head back.

He said: "I wasn't happy when I came back. I was playing regularly even if it was in the Championship, and obviously to be on the bench, I was a bit frustrated," reports ESPN.

"The manager said to me that I didn't look happy when I came back. I said 'yeah, it's true'. Then I started the West Ham game when I didn't expect it. It shows in football you really need to be ready at any time."

Coquelin will likely line up for Arsenal against West Bromwich Albion this afternoon.
